What is the first step to haul your firearm into a tree stand?

Hunter’s Tip Before hauling a firearm into a stand, make sure it is unloaded. Also, you can avoid getting debris in the barrel by placing a cover over the muzzle. Once you are securely in the stand, check for obstructions before you load.

What is one step of loading your firearm?

To load a firearm safely: Point the muzzle in a safe direction. If the firearm has a safety, put the safety on if you can open the action and load the firearm with the safety on. Keep your finger off the trigger and outside the trigger guard.

What is the first thing you should do before crossing a fence with a firearm?

Always unload guns before crossing fences or other obstacles or before negotiating rough terrain. If alone, place the gun on the other side of the obstacle, cross, and pull the gun toward you by the butt.

What is the safest way to transport a firearm?

Always unload and case firearms before transporting them. In many states, this may be the law. The action should be open or the gun broken down, whichever makes the firearm safest if it’s mishandled. What are the first three priorities if you become lost?

Remind yourself that most lost hunters are located within 48 to 72 hours. You will shorten the time if you follow the guidelines in this course and remember these three priorities: shelter, fire, and signal.

When making sure a firearm is unloaded what must be checked?

To make sure it’s unloaded, open the action, and check both the chamber and the magazine for cartridges or shotshells. You can store a bolt-action firearm safely by storing the bolt separately from the firearm.

What should you wear when using a treestand?

The best safety precaution for treestand hunting is to wear a full-body harness and stay tethered to the tree or lifeline the entire time you‘re off the ground. A full-body harness secures the bowhunter to the tree or lifeline with a tether, which is located on the harness’s back, just below the neck.

When climbing into or out of a tree stand, always use three points of contact with your hands and feet. Keep a firm hold on the climbing system as you enter or leave a platform, and don’t let go until you’re certain you are secure. Stay tethered to the tree.

What parts of your body should have protection whenever you shoot a firearm?

Always wear proper hearing and eye protection. With most rifle firing, you should consider wearing both earplugs and earmuffs. Eye protection should include protection at the side of the eyes.

What is the proper way to get a firearm into and down from a tree stand?

Use a haul line of heavy cord attached to your stand to bring up your hunting equipment or to lower it prior to climbing down from your stand. If using a firearm, attach the haul line to the firearm’s sling so that the firearm hangs with the muzzle pointed down.

How should you pass a fishing boat boaters Ed?

To pass a fishing boat, you should steer to the starboard side, which is the right-hand side of a boat. This means both boats will pass each other on their port side, or left-hand side.

What is the problem with using your boat’s engine to drive it onto a trailer?

NOTE ” While many people drive the boat onto the trailer, it isn’t advised. Using the engine to assist trailering erodes the ramp bed, can lead to debris being sucked into the engine, and can cause an accident!
